As the time I visited was the off season, there were hardly any people around so it was nice and quiet. The unit accommodation is super clean and nice and comfortable. The balcony and patio has great views of the water, and gets the sun most of the day. Easy to walk to a little deli style supermarket/grocery store- has everything you need- real Sicilian sandwiches on fresh breads, all the basics, lots of beer and wine- just a cool little store!! The beach is really 200 meters from your door. Beach is very clean and has sand dunes up one end. If you want to relax and do NOTHING- Sampieri is highly recommended..........But apparently not in August- tourist season for the Italians from the bigger cities.

Sampieri is a small village, which is quite famous because...
Sampieri is a small village, which is quite famous because of its amazing beach, which is totally worth it. There are many local restaurants to go to, and enjoy delicious sea food, so there is no problem in bumping into any of them by chance. Be careful, because if you really want to enjoy Sampieri and other surrounding beaches you should get a car.
